FRIDAY, APRIL 18, 2008NEW YORK COMIC CON: DC NATION PANELNEW YORK DC Comics on Friday staged its traditional DC Nation panel.
Below are live highlights:
Panelists included Dan DiDio, Bob Wayne, Jann Jones, Keith Giffen, Gail Simone, Jimmy Palmiotti, Sean McKeever, Geoff Johns, Peter Tomasi and Ian Sattler.
* Johns on The Blackest Night: "The dead rise. They kick a lot of ass. It should be a lot of fun."
* DiDio reiterated that DC Univese Zero was a thank you to readers for 104 weekly issues and surveyed audience members for what they think will be in Final Crisis.
* After claiming that he has been criticized for confusional at previous DC Nation panls, DiDio then presented the "DC Nation Time Boards" on the big screen -- for 15 seconds.
* DiDio laid out the Final Crisis plans: the main series by Grant Morrison and J.G. Jones; Final Crisis: Legion of Three Worlds by Geoff Johns and George Perez; Final Crisis: Revelation by Greg Rucka and Philip Tan; Final Crisis: Requiem by Peter Tomasi and Doug Mahnke; Final Crisis: Superman Beyond, in 3D, by Morrison and Aaron Lopresti; Final Crisis: Rogue's Revenge by Johns and Scott Kolins; Final Crisis: Submit and Final Crisis: Resist, written by Johns, Morrison and Rucka; and Final Crisis: Rage of the Red Lanterns.
* Simone said in Wonder Woman, the best scientists come up with a formula take down Wonder Woman, thus creating a new rogue's gallery for Wonder Woman.
Someone is going to create a new race of Amazons. "We are going to have a new Wonder Woman -- who is a man," she said.
* McKeever will be dealing with Cassie's relationship with Ares.
Supergirl: Cosmic Adventures in the Eighth Grade will be a six-issue kids mini-series launching this fall. The series is by Landry Walker and Eric Jones.
* Wayne said Tiny Titans #1 has completely sold out, but will be a Free Comic Book Day offering.
* DC released an image promoting a new Power Girl series, written by Justin Gray and Jimmy Palmiotti, with art by Amanda Conner.

* Johns said Krypto is "all over" his and James Robinson's plans for Superman.
* McKeever said to watch for Teen Titans #62 and Wonder Dog.
* DiDio said he will explain the Countdown poster image in one of his upcoming columns.
* Johns said that there are plans for Sinestro's sister.
* Johns and Robinson have about 2-1/2 years worth of Superman stories planned.
* Superman Prime's role in Final Crisis? Johns said he goes into the 31st Century and "kind of does his thing."
* DiDio said Trinity features Bruce Wayne as Batman and takes place before Final Crisis.
* DiDio said Catwoman will continue to be seen in the DC Universe even after her book has finished.
* Asked about Flash, DiDio said, "If you're a huge Flash fan, I ask you to bear with us for a little while," he said. "We've got some great stuff coming up."
* Johns said the JSA Annual #1 is called "Welcome to Earth-2" finds Power Girl back on Earth 2. It is drawn by Jerry Ordway.
Following that will be the ongoing Power Girl series.
* DiDio said there was "some disappointment" to Countdown. "We are not going to disappoint you again. We are not working along those lines."
* Wayne said there are no plans for Young Justice collections.
* Asked about breakout stars, DiDio said to look out for Tan.
* Mark Waid's last issue on The Brave and The Bold will be #16.
